A new essay about Varlam Shalamov

To the 100th anniversary of the birth of the poet and prose writer Varlam Shalamov, a new essay has been written. The theme of the Red Terror, the total destruction of people in the camps of the Gulag, the tragedy of the Holocaust has long been present in the work of Alexander Korotko. The most piercing lines about those who suffered the fate of surviving inhuman tortures and some – to die, and others – to survive, but all the remaining days carry a pain that can not be understood and realized by those who managed to escape the horrors of the hell of the earth. The essay “Varlam Shalamov, prisoner of the Gulag”, behind simple words of which lie both suffering and compassion, all the same about the strength of the spirit. No wonder the author ends his work this way: “… Varlam Shalamov finds the soul of Job.”
